About Cplta Shane Miller

Cplta Shane Miller is the Land Digital Fluency Project Owner at Chevron in San Ramon, California, with a diverse background in both public and private sectors.

Current Role at Chevron

Shane Miller is currently serving as the Land Digital Fluency Project Owner at Chevron in San Ramon, California, United States. In this role, he is responsible for supporting communication and training initiatives related to Chevron's digital transformation efforts across various business units. His work aims to enhance the digital fluency of the employees within the organization. Additionally, Miller holds the position of Land Representative - Ownership at Chevron, further contributing to his extensive role within the company.

Professional Experience at Chevron

Shane Miller has been a part of Chevron since 2013, demonstrating a significant track record within the company. He began as a Title Land Representative (2013-2015) before progressing to Land Representative (2015-2016). His experience within Chevron encompasses roles focused on land ownership and representation. Over the years, he has played a critical role in various projects, showcasing his versatility and commitment to the organization.

Independent Work as Title Specialist

Before his tenure at Chevron, Shane Miller worked independently as a Title Specialist from 2011 to 2013. During this period, he developed specialized skills in title examination, which laid a solid foundation for his subsequent roles in the oil and gas industry. This independent work is a testament to his expertise and ability to manage complex tasks autonomously.

Legislative and Political Campaign Experience

Miller has diverse experience in the public sector, having worked as a Legislative Analyst in the Office of the Minority Leader at the West Virginia State Senate. His tenure at the state senate includes periods in both 2010 and 2011. Additionally, he was involved in campaign staff activities for Frank Deem's State Senate campaign in 2010. These roles contributed to his understanding of legislative processes and political campaign management.

Educational Background

Shane Miller holds a Bachelor of Arts degree in History and in Political Science from West Virginia University. He continued his education at West Virginia University, earning a Master of Arts in Leadership. Furthermore, he studied Political Science at Marshall University from 2009 to 2013. This comprehensive educational background has provided him with a deep understanding of both historical contexts and political frameworks, informing his professional endeavors.
